IP Rights In A Borderless Internet: CJEU Developments On Geo-Blocking, Copyright And Trade Marks
Two recent CJEU cases demonstrate how geo-blocking intersects with intellectual property rights in the digital age. The Anne Frank diary case clarifies when geo-blocking can prevent copyright infringement claims, while the PAUSCHA trade mark dispute questions whether domain names can infringe national trade marks when websites are geo-blocked from protected territories.
